Poor ladies! though their business be to play,
'Tis hard they must be busy night and day:
Why should they want the privilege of men,
And take some small diversions now and then?
Had women been the makers of our laws;
(And why they were not, I can see no cause;)
The men should slave at cards from morn to night;
And female pleasures be to read and write.
